def setUp(self):
self.asn1Spec = rfc5280.Certificate()
def testDerCodec(self):
substrate = pem.readBase64fromText(self.cert_pem_text)
asn1Object, rest = der_decode(substrate, asn1Spec=self.asn1Spec)
assert not rest
assert asn1Object.prettyPrint()
assert der_encode(asn1Object) == substrate
perm_id_oid = rfc4043.id_on_permanentIdentifier
assigner_oid = univ.ObjectIdentifier('1.3.6.1.4.1.22112.48')
permanent_identifier_found = False
for extn in asn1Object['tbsCertificate']['extensions']:
if extn['extnID'] == rfc5280.id_ce_subjectAltName:
extnValue, rest = der_decode(extn['extnValue'],
asn1Spec=rfc5280.SubjectAltName())
assert not rest
assert extnValue.prettyPrint()
assert der_encode(extnValue) == extn['extnValue']
for gn in extnValue:
if gn['otherName'].hasValue():
assert gn['otherName']['type-id'] == perm_id_oid
onValue, rest = der_decode(gn['otherName']['value'],
asn1Spec=rfc4043.PermanentIdentifier())
assert not rest
assert onValue.prettyPrint()
assert der_encode(onValue) == gn['otherName']['value']
assert onValue['assigner'] == assigner_oid
permanent_identifier_found = True
assert permanent_identifier_found
